Lois Law Frett

February 25, 1926 - November 30, 2016

Lois was born in Sioux City, Iowa to parents Glen and Hilda Law. She was the oldest of four children. The family moved to Pierson, Iowa where Lois attended a one room country grade school. She graduated from Pierson High School. After high school, she joined the Nurse Cadet Corps where she went to nursing school. On graduation, her services as a nurse were no longer needed by the military so she began her career in Sioux City doing private duty nursing.


It was there that she met her future husband, Edward Frett. They were married on September 26, 1947. They settled in Norwalk, California when Edward was discharged from the US Navy following the Korean Conflict and started a family.


Lois worked for 35 years as an emergency room RN. Upon retirement, Lois and Edward moved to the Sun Lakes community in Banning. She enjoyed knitting caps for veterans undergoing chemo treatment at their local VA hospital, made quilts for Head Start programs and teddy bears for the local police and fire dept. and being part of the Red Hat Society. When she could no longer live alone she moved to assisted living in Whittier and then to Lakewood Gardens (Downey) to be close to family.


She is preceded in death by her parents, her husband Edward, sons Michael and Steven and brothers John “Jack”, Paul and Don.


She is survived by daughter, Nancy and her husband Kevin Merrick, grand children David and wife Cecilia, Sarah and husband James Granger, great granddaughter Rebecca Granger.
